为了账号安全,请及时绑定邮箱和手机立即绑定

如何删除mysql数据库中重复的数据(部分重复)?

如何删除mysql数据库中重复的数据(部分重复)?

子期不遇 2017-04-20 17:26:50
最近手上的数据库有很多重复的数据,其中某一项字段(假设为A字段)数据是重复的,其他字段重复不管,如何写sql语句来删除重复的A字段的值,但是要保留一个A字段的值。麻烦有回答问题的好心人把在书写sql语句的时候,把相关的字段代表的意思标注一下。例如:delete from table_name where id in(2,3);table_name需要操作的表名
查看完整描述

3 回答

?
ruibin

TA贡献358条经验 获得超213个赞

其实还有种比较简单的方法,用这种方法可以查找出不重复复的值。distinct,你可以搜索下

select  distinct(task_id),taskid from task;


查看完整回答
反对 回复 2017-04-20
  • 3 回答
  • 1 关注
  • 2142 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信